when you do changes in skin settings screen it applied automatically.

to apply skin on the model, select the part of the model (or whole model) that you want to apply skin, and in texture manager press set skin.

If texture doesnt appear or your model turns into a single color or some gets set of stripes, then your model is not unwrapped(not uv mapped), and this is a whole big thing itself on modelling process

modelling-unwrapping-creating textures-rigging-animating.

Alan, were you using 3DS MAX? If so, I've found it to do some weird stuff sometimes; mainly, 'flipping' the normals of a bunch of polygons. To see if max is doing this, right-click on the viewport word ("Perspective", "Front", etc.) and look at your settings; make sure "Force 2-sided" is NOT checked.

My guess, off hand, is that the UV map is 'correct', but the actual model faces that don't seem to be getting the texture are 'flipped' (re: normals facing inward, not outward). Just a guess though... \:\)
